    "editor1": "Nathaniel Tan Leong An: Hosts India delivered a commanding performance in the inaugural World Yogasana Championships 2026, clinching five of the first six gold medals on offer to underline their dominance in the sport\u2019s biggest-ever global showcase at the Eka Arena in Ahmedabad.<p>West Bengal\u2019s Abhay Burman (senior male) and Ritu Mondal (senior female) set the tone for the hosts with gold medal-winning performances in the Traditional Yogasana category, sparking a remarkable run for the Indian contingent before an enthusiastic home crowd.<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>Burman secured India\u2019s first gold medal of the World Yogasana Championships with a score of 63.42 points. He was comfortably ahead of Indonesia\u2019s Arkan Riyanto (57.23), who claimed silver, while Uzbekistan\u2019s Alan took home the bronze medal with 53.21 points.<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>Reflecting on his historic achievement, Burman said, \u201cWinning the first gold medal of the inaugural World Yogasana Championships for India is a moment I will cherish forever. Competing at home in front of such passionate supporters gave me immense confidence, and I am proud to contribute to India\u2019s strong start in this historic event.\u201d<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>Ritu Mondal followed with another gold for India in the senior female category, scoring 64.33 points. Kazakhstan\u2019s Aizhan Kuanyshbayeva (58.97) secured silver, while Hong Kong\u2019s Lam Nga Man (56.98) earned bronze.<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>Describing the significance of the occasion, Mondal said, \u201cThis championship is a landmark moment for every Yogasana athlete. Winning a medal for India is a dream come true. I began training at the age of 12, and after eight years of hard work and dedication, achieving this at 20 makes the moment even more special. I would like to thank my coach, manager, and the entire team for guiding and supporting me throughout this journey.\"<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>The only event not won by India came in the Senior A Male category, where Singapore\u2019s Nathaniel Tan Leong An topped the podium with 55.37 points to prevent a complete Indian sweep. Tanzania\u2019s Karimu Swafi claimed silver with 54.99 points, while India\u2019s Sumir Gnawali secured bronze with 54.00 points.<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>India quickly returned to the top as Ritu Thakur captured gold in the Senior A Female category with 63.50 points, edging Argentina\u2019s Nabila Sol Barraza (62.04), while Kenya\u2019s Awuor Saulinha took bronze.<\/p>\r\n\r\n<p>Roshan Thapa added another gold medal to India\u2019s tally by winning the Senior B Male category with an impressive score of 65.67 points.
